Project Summary
Pathfinder Elementary was the first site designated by the Seattle School District for installation of solar equipment and the site of a major Seattle Green Power kickoff event in January 2002. Construction began in June 2002 and the project actually began producing power in January 2003. The success of the aptly named Pathfinder project led to a number of subsequent collaborative efforts (e.g.Greenwood Elementary School, Orca Elementary School and Washington Middle School), between Seattle City Light and the Seattle School District to demonstrate the practicality of photovoltaics as a strategy for de-centralized "off-grid" power production in an urban environment.
